Position Introduction

Earn 1-3 credits engaged in hands on learning on the MCC Student Farm. Assist with all
aspects of vegetable and fruit production from seed to sales. Must be willing to work in hot, cold, wet, buggy environments. Must be able to lift 30 pounds. Visiting local farms and instruction on agricultural marketing is included in this paid internship. Intro to Ag Practicum AGR 107, or instructor approval, is a required prerequisite.
